Zambia voluntary work

Both of the Zambia voluntary work programmes are dedicated to providing care and support to some of the Zambia’s most vulnerable and disadvantaged children, many of whom have been orphaned as a result of Africa’s AIDS epidemic. Volunteers can support the Zambia voluntary work programmes by coaching sports to providing assistance at a medical clinic.
